The Seashell and the Clergyman was directed in 1927 by Germaine Dulac, after a surrealist screenplay by Antonin Artaud. The first authentic surrealistic movie. … 416-2 416 nueva org nuevaorg Seashell Clergyman Germaine Dulac surrealism Antonin Artaud cinema
